Project Manager - Civil Construction

Sunland Asphalt is looking for a seasoned Civil Project Manager to join our growing team in Phoenix, AZ. The Civil Project Manager plans, directs and coordinates all activities of the designated projects from inception to completion. This position is responsible for delivering a quality product, controlling project costs and meeting scheduling deadlines in order to achieve the highest customer satisfaction.

ESSENTIAL DUTIES:
  • Employee shall perform all duties and responsibilities with Sunland's Core Values at the forefront.
  • Review project estimate, proposal, specifications and plans to develop, implement and manage the project schedule, budget, staffing requirements and equipment needs.
  • Coordinate project schedule, requirements, expectations and goals with production team, contractors, sub-contractors, utility providers and required governmental agencies prior to commencement of work.
  • Must be an advocate of safety and follow safety policies and procedures.
  • Obtain any necessary permits and or licenses required by the job.
  • Participate and/or lead preconstruction meetings including meetings with Project Stakeholders.
  • Collaborate with Superintendent, Foreman and Project Consultant to determine production schedule.
  • Establish work plan in conjunction with Superintendent and Foreman for each phase of the project.
  • Track progress and review project tasks and modify schedules, plans or processes as needed to meet project goals.
  • Enforce safety regulations and proper job site management.
  • Oversee the financial components of the project; work with Project Consultant, Superintendent and Foreman to capture, record, assess and ensure the project stays within budget and is profitable.
  • Partner with Estimating Team to complete a project hand-off process to ensure a smooth transition from estimating to production in which the necessary information is passed along for a successful project.
  • Participate in bid reviews.
  • Prepare project reports for management and customers regarding job costs and project schedule.
  • Provide technical advice to project team in order to resolve problems.
  • Oversee project quality control throughout the construction process in order to make sure the project is completed in accordance with project specifications & plans in addition to meeting or exceeding the customer's expectations.
  • Motivate, mentor and develop direct reports.
  • Any and all other duties assigned.
